Understanding the definition and purpose of face serums
Face serums are lightweight, fast-absorbing liquids that concentrate active ingredients such as vitamins, peptides, acids, and botanical extracts. The primary purpose of a serum is to deliver a high payload of functional ingredients — for example, vitamin C or niacinamide — in a base designed for deep absorption. Unlike heavier creams, serums do not primarily focus on occlusion or barrier reinforcement; instead, they modulate cellular activity, collagen production, and antioxidant defenses to produce visible changes. Key benefits: hydration, anti-aging, acne prevention, and skin brightening
Serums are formulated to deliver measurable benefits across several skin concerns. Hydration-focused serums use humectants and lightweight emollients to attract and retain moisture, often reducing trans-epidermal water loss when layered under a moisturizer. Anti-aging benefits are achieved with ingredients that stimulate collagen synthesis and cellular renewal; an effective anti-wrinkle serum will combine peptides, retinoid precursors, or growth factor mimetics with antioxidants to protect newly formed collagen. For acne-prone skin, targeted formulations such as niacinamide serum for oily skin reduce sebum production, calm inflammation, and minimize post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ation. Brightening serums commonly feature vitamin C, niacinamide, or mild exfoliants to even tone and increase radiance. Choosing the right serum for different skin types
Selecting a serum depends on skin type and core concerns. Oily and acne-prone individuals often benefit most from lightweight, non-comedogenic serums that regulate sebum and soothe inflammation; niacinamide serum for oily skin is a typical recommendation because it balances oil without stripping. Dry skin requires formulations with humectants and lipid-replenishing ingredients, sometimes combined with antioxidant skin compounds to reduce oxidative stress. Sensitive skins need low-irritant actives and gentle delivery systems, while mature skin benefits from richer anti wrinkle serum actives and peptides to support structural integrity. Expert tips for maximizing effectiveness
To get the most from any face serum, layer order, application technique, and consistency matter. Apply serums to clean, slightly damp skin so actives penetrate more effectively; follow with a moisturizer to lock in benefits and a sunscreen in the morning to protect against UV-related degradation of ingredients like vitamin C. When introducing potent actives such as retinoids or concentrated vitamin C, start gradually to build tolerance and avoid barrier disruption. Comparing serums and moisturizers: when to use each
While face serum and moisturizer are complementary, their functions differ and influence purchase decisions. Serums are active-focused treatment products, while moisturizers are barrier-focused and designed to hydrate and protect the skin surface. For many consumers, the optimal approach is serum-first to treat targeted concerns, followed by a moisturizer to seal in actives and provide long-lasting hydration.
